It’s a nice game, but there are several issues:

  • When moving to the right, the character is offset by half a tile, which makes navigation confusing. This also seems to happen to the monsters.
  • When enabling fullscreen you have a very large view of the which makes it easy to spot the monsters and items in other rooms, even without entering them.
  • When not enabling fullscreen the UI elements on the right go out of bounds and the dialogue texts from the moustache guy overlap with each other.
  • The amount of hearts doesn’t match the actual amount of HP you have. I only realized my HP was increasing after reading someone’s comment here and seeing the HP text on the right.
  • The interaction with the moustache guy is broken. Neither X or B seem to do anything.
  • The music is nice, but some sound effects would make it even better as it gives the player more feedback that their actions do something.

Also, the screenshot above the game is confusing. I was trying to click the play button until I realized the actual game is below it.

Overall, very nice concept but it needs more polish.
